Short summary
I evaluated a novel sea-ice concentration data product based on satellite microwave observations during December 1972 to May 1977. I used Landsat-1 satellite images obtained in 1974 in the Arctic, classified into water and ice. My evaluation provides results very similar to evaluations carried out for sea-ice concentration data products based on more recent satellite observations. I suggest that the novel sea-ice concentration data product is a useful extension back in time.
